CSS是前端開發(fā)語言中非常重要的一部分,它可實現(xiàn)不同的設(shè)計和樣式。其中,獲取列寬度的功能對于開發(fā)者來說非常重要。在本文中,我們將介紹如何使用CSS獲取列寬度。
首先,我們需要使用HTML中的table標簽創(chuàng)建表格。在需要設(shè)置列寬度的單元格中,我們可以使用CSS中的“width”屬性來設(shè)置它們的寬度。例如,我們可以使用以下代碼為第一列設(shè)置寬度為200像素:
我們可以使用“td:first-child”選擇器來選擇第一列單元格,并將其寬度設(shè)置為200像素。
如果我們想要為所有列設(shè)置相同的寬度,我們可以使用下面的代碼:
這將為表格中的每個單元格設(shè)置一個寬度為100像素的寬度。
此外,我們還可以使用CSS中的“table-layout”屬性來控制列寬度。這個屬性有兩個值:“auto”和“fixed”。默認值是“auto”。如果我們將其設(shè)置為“fixed”,則將強制設(shè)置表格的寬度,而不允許它根據(jù)表格內(nèi)容自動調(diào)整寬度。
例如,以下代碼將使用“table-layout: fixed;”屬性強制設(shè)置表格寬度:
這將為表格設(shè)置一個100%的寬度,并將其固定為該大小。
需要注意的是,在使用CSS設(shè)置列寬度時,我們還需要考慮表格的其他屬性。比如,如果單元格內(nèi)包含文本或圖像,我們可能需要在CSS樣式中設(shè)置單元格的“padding”和“border”屬性來保持表格的整潔。
結(jié)論:上述就是一些基本的CSS獲取列寬度的方法。我們可以使用這些屬性來設(shè)置表格的樣式,讓表格看起來更漂亮。
首先,我們需要使用HTML中的table標簽創(chuàng)建表格。在需要設(shè)置列寬度的單元格中,我們可以使用CSS中的“width”屬性來設(shè)置它們的寬度。例如,我們可以使用以下代碼為第一列設(shè)置寬度為200像素:
table td:first-child { width: 200px; }
我們可以使用“td:first-child”選擇器來選擇第一列單元格,并將其寬度設(shè)置為200像素。
如果我們想要為所有列設(shè)置相同的寬度,我們可以使用下面的代碼:
table td { width: 100px; }
這將為表格中的每個單元格設(shè)置一個寬度為100像素的寬度。
此外,我們還可以使用CSS中的“table-layout”屬性來控制列寬度。這個屬性有兩個值:“auto”和“fixed”。默認值是“auto”。如果我們將其設(shè)置為“fixed”,則將強制設(shè)置表格的寬度,而不允許它根據(jù)表格內(nèi)容自動調(diào)整寬度。
例如,以下代碼將使用“table-layout: fixed;”屬性強制設(shè)置表格寬度:
table { width: 100%; table-layout: fixed; }
這將為表格設(shè)置一個100%的寬度,并將其固定為該大小。
需要注意的是,在使用CSS設(shè)置列寬度時,我們還需要考慮表格的其他屬性。比如,如果單元格內(nèi)包含文本或圖像,我們可能需要在CSS樣式中設(shè)置單元格的“padding”和“border”屬性來保持表格的整潔。
結(jié)論:上述就是一些基本的CSS獲取列寬度的方法。我們可以使用這些屬性來設(shè)置表格的樣式,讓表格看起來更漂亮。